08/04/2010· Generation of electricity in a coal-fired steam station is similar to a nuclear station. The difference is the source of heat. The burning of coal replaces fissioning, or splitting , of uranium atoms as the source of heat. The heat turns water to steam in steam generators. The steam is then used to drive turbine generators. 1. Firebox

Diagram showing the main parts of a coal-fired power station. Coal is held in storage until needed, then is pulverised to form a thick dust. This is blown into the boiler where it burns at high temperature. This heats water in pipes and turns it into steam. A coal-fired power station or coal power plant is a thermal power station which burns coal to generate electricity. Worldwide there are about 8,500 coal-fired power stations totaling over 2,000 gigawatts capacity, about a third of the world's electricity. 04/05/2011· An 1800 MW coal-fired power station fitted with the limestone-gypsum type of flue gas desulphurisation (FGD) plant will produce about 500 000 tonnes of gypsum per year. Coal fired power plants also known as coal fired power stations are facilities that burn coal to make steam in order to generate electricity.These stations, seen in Figure 1, provide ~40% of the world's electricity. Coal: In a coal based thermal power plant, coal is transported from coal mines to the generating station. Generally, bituminous coal or brown coal is used as fuel. The coal is stored in either 'dead storage' or in 'live storage'. Dead storage is generally 40 days backup coal storage which is used when coal supply is unavailable.

At present 54.09% or 93918.38 MW of total electricity production in India is from Coal Based Thermal Power Station under coal fired CFB Boiler. A coal based thermal power plant converts the chemical energy of the coal into electrical energy. This is achieved by raising the steam in the CFB boilers, expanding it through the turbine and coupling the turbines to the generators
